Step 1: Create a Reusable Video Template in Canva
First, you need a clean and simple TikTok video format that works across posts. Use Canva to design a video template you can repurpose hundreds of times.
Here’s how to build it:
- Use a royalty-free video background (city scenes, nature clips, abstract visuals)
- Add a text box in the center or the top third of the screen
- Set your brand font and color (optional, but good for consistency)
- Save the template so you can use Canva’s bulk create feature later
This format is perfect for motivational quotes, facts, tips, or any text-based TikTok niche.
Step 2: Generate Video Ideas with ChatGPT and Google Sheets
Open ChatGPT and prompt it like this:
“Give me 50 motivational quotes, catchy TikTok video titles, and captions with hashtags in a table format.”
Copy the table into a Google Sheet and add two more columns:
- Video ID (001, 002, 003…)
- Status (write “not posted” for now)
This sheet becomes the content dashboard from which your automation pulls.
Step 3: Use Canva’s Bulk Create to Auto-Generate Videos
Inside Canva:
- Open your saved template
- Go to Apps → Bulk Create
- Import your Google Sheet or a CSV version
- Connect the quote field to your text box
- Let Canva auto-generate dozens of videos based on your spreadsheet
Download the entire batch as MP4 files. These videos are now ready for scheduling.
Step 4: Upload to Cloud Storage
To automate video access, upload your MP4s to Dropbox or Google Drive.
Make sure the file names match the Video ID column in your Google Sheet (001.mp4, 002.mp4, etc). This makes it easy for the automation tool to pull the correct file.
Step 5: Set Up Automation with Make.com
Now for the fun part: automation.
Go to Make.com and build a scenario that does the following:
- Check your Google Sheet for rows marked “not posted.”
- Find the matching video in Dropbox or Drive using the Video ID
- Uses Airshare’s TikTok API to upload the video with the caption from your sheet
- Mark the row in your Google Sheet as “posted.”
Set this to run every 24 hours. You’ll be posting consistently without lifting a finger.
Step 6: Choose a Niche and Stay Consistent
Automation only works if your content strategy is clear. Choose a niche like:
- Motivational quotes
- Productivity tips
- Daily affirmations
- Business facts
- Fitness hacks
Batch 30 to 60 videos upfront and let the system run. Analyze what content performs best, update your spreadsheet with more quotes, and keep scaling.
Step 7: Monetize Your Growth
Once your account gains traction (even with 1,000 to 10,000 followers), you can start monetizing:
- Add affiliate links in your bio using tools like Linktree or Beacons
- Offer sponsored posts
- Drive traffic to a newsletter, digital product, or website
- Apply for the TikTok Creator Fund or Creativity Program once you’re eligible
The key is volume and consistency, which your automation handles for you.
